What if the measure of your life isn't what you achieve, but what you pass on? In this daily Bible devotional, we explore what it means to build a legacy that lasts - not through accomplishments, but through discipleship, character, and pointing others to Jesus.Discover how to turn influence into lasting legacy through four practical, biblical principles from Psalm 72, 2 Timothy 2:2, and Matthew 28:18-20. Learn why your greatest impact won't be what you do - it will be who you disciple.In This Video:✅ Why legacy is built by multiplying through others, not doing more✅ How your character speaks louder than your achievements✅ The difference between building projects and investing in people✅ Practical steps to disciple others and create lasting impactKey Scriptures:• Psalm 72:17-19 – Praying for enduring influence• 2 Timothy 2:2 – The multiplication principle of discipleship• Matthew 28:18-20 – Jesus' model of investing in peopleThis Week's Challenge:Identify one person to disciple. Focus on one character trait to grow. Re-evaluate your calendar to invest in what lasts.
